Antonino Salibra (Università Cà Foscari, Venezia, Italy), From Lambda Calculi to Universal Algebra and Topology: Back and Forth

Abstract

Answering a question by Honsell and Plotkin, we show that there are two equations between lambda terms, the so-called subtractive equations, consistent with lambda calculus but not contemporaneously satisfied in any Scott continuous model.

We also relate the subtractive equations to the open problem of the order-incompleteness of lambda calculus, by studying the connection between the notion of absolute unorderability in a specific point and a weaker notion of subtractivity, namely n-subtractivity, for partially ordered algebras. Finally we study the relation between n-subtractivity and relativized separation conditions in topological algebras, obtaining an incompleteness theorem for a general topological semantics of lambda calculus.
